Small Red Lines Under Nails Could Signal Hidden Health Issues

  • Splinter hemorrhages are tiny blood vessel breaks that create red or brown lines under fingernails or toenails
  • While often caused by minor trauma, these nail markings can occasionally indicate serious conditions like heart infections or autoimmune disease
  • Medical evaluation is essential when splinter hemorrhages appear without injury or alongside symptoms like fever, fatigue, or joint pain

Discovering unusual streaks beneath your nails might seem like a minor cosmetic concern, but these small markings deserve attention. Splinter hemorrhages—thin red or brown lines that appear under fingernails or toenails—occur when tiny blood vessels called capillaries break and bleed beneath the nail bed.

The name comes from their appearance, which resembles wood splinters trapped under the nail. These vertical lines typically measure just a few millimeters in length and can appear in single or multiple nails at once.

Most cases result from everyday accidents. Stubbing a toe, slamming a finger in a door, or repetitive pressure from athletic activities can damage the delicate blood vessels beneath nails. However, when these markings appear without obvious injury, they may point to underlying health conditions requiring medical assessment.

“Splinter hemorrhages can be a sign of several systemic diseases,” explains the medical literature. The appearance varies depending on how recently the bleeding occurred—fresh hemorrhages appear bright red, while older ones fade to brown or black as the blood breaks down over time.

Beyond trauma, splinter hemorrhages can indicate bacterial endocarditis, a serious infection of the heart’s inner lining and valves. This condition occurs when bacteria enter the bloodstream and attach to damaged heart tissue, creating inflammation that can affect small blood vessels throughout the body, including those under the nails.

Other serious causes include vasculitis (blood vessel inflammation), psoriatic arthritis, lupus, rheumatoid arthritis, and antiphospholipid syndrome. These autoimmune conditions can damage blood vessels systemically, with nail changes serving as visible warning signs.

Less commonly, splinter hemorrhages may accompany blood clotting disorders, certain cancers, or infections like septicemia. Medications that affect blood clotting can also increase the likelihood of these nail markings developing.

The location and pattern of splinter hemorrhages provide diagnostic clues. Those appearing near the nail tip more often result from minor trauma, while marks closer to the cuticle or affecting multiple nails simultaneously raise concern for systemic disease.

Additional symptoms requiring prompt medical attention include fever, unexplained fatigue, joint pain or swelling, shortness of breath, chest pain, or painful nodules on fingers or toes. These accompanying signs suggest the splinter hemorrhages may reflect a more serious underlying condition.

Diagnosis begins with a thorough medical history and physical examination. Healthcare providers ask about recent injuries, existing medical conditions, medications, and other symptoms. Blood tests can reveal signs of infection, inflammation, or autoimmune activity.

For suspected heart involvement, additional testing may include blood cultures to identify bacteria, echocardiography to visualize heart valves and chambers, and other cardiac assessments. Rheumatological testing helps identify autoimmune conditions affecting connective tissue and blood vessels.

Treatment depends entirely on the underlying cause. Splinter hemorrhages from minor trauma require no treatment—they simply grow out naturally with the nail over several weeks to months. Protecting nails from further injury and maintaining good nail hygiene supports healing.

When systemic disease causes the hemorrhages, addressing the underlying condition becomes essential. Bacterial endocarditis requires aggressive antibiotic therapy, often administered intravenously in hospital settings. Severe cases may need surgical intervention to repair or replace damaged heart valves.

Autoimmune conditions causing splinter hemorrhages typically require long-term management with immunosuppressive medications, anti-inflammatory drugs, or disease-modifying treatments. The specific regimen depends on the particular diagnosis and disease severity.

Prevention strategies focus on protecting nails from injury during daily activities and sports. Wearing appropriate protective gear, keeping nails trimmed to moderate length, and avoiding harsh nail treatments help reduce trauma risk. For those with known systemic conditions, maintaining regular medical follow-up and medication compliance helps prevent complications.

Good cardiovascular health practices—including dental hygiene to prevent oral bacteria from entering the bloodstream—reduce endocarditis risk. Individuals with heart valve abnormalities or previous endocarditis should inform healthcare providers before dental or surgical procedures, as preventive antibiotics may be recommended.

While most splinter hemorrhages result from ordinary bumps and bruises, they sometimes serve as early warning signs of serious health conditions. The key lies in recognizing when these nail changes warrant medical evaluation—particularly when they appear without explanation, affect multiple nails, or accompany other concerning symptoms.

Adults over 40 should maintain awareness of changes in their nails and other physical markers, as age increases risk for many conditions associated with splinter hemorrhages. Regular health screenings and open communication with healthcare providers support early detection and treatment of underlying problems.

Anyone noticing unexplained splinter hemorrhages, especially with additional symptoms, should schedule a medical appointment rather than dismissing the findings as insignificant. Early evaluation allows timely diagnosis and treatment, potentially preventing serious complications from conditions like endocarditis or autoimmune disease.
